I did 10k+ on my 600rr without ever needing to adjust the chain, that was just lubing occasionally (takes 2 mins) and cleaning every now and then (5mins).

If your doing 10K+ a year then maybe its worth buying a scott oiler, otherwise sod that, its not worth the effort.
